// Doc reference:
|
||
|
|
// https://www.navidrome.org/docs/usage/library/artwork/#mediafiles
|
||
|
|
// Navidrome resolves mediafile artwork in this order:
|
||
|
|
// 1. Embedded image from the mediafile itself
|
||
|
|
// 2. For multi-disc albums, disc-level artwork
|
||
|
|
// 3. Album cover art
|
||
|
|
//
|
||
|
|
// FakeFS cannot synthesize taglib-readable embedded JPEGs, so scenario (1)
|
||
|
|
// is covered by the existing embedded-art album tests (which currently
|
||
|
|
// Skip under FakeFS). The tests below cover (2) and (3): the fallback
|
||
|
|
// chain for tracks without embedded art.
